**Action Item PM-14: Add circuit breaker for the Corvette pricing API**

During the outage, retries against the degraded Corvette upstream amplified load and extended recovery by forty minutes. We will introduce a circuit breaker with a five-failure trip threshold, a thirty-second half-open probe, and cached fallback responses. Maintainers must review trip metrics weekly until the thresholds stabilize. Design notes and the tuning worksheet are available here.

wiki page, tahaf-tajog: https://jira.ordindyn.corp/pipeline

## Ownership

The TilePouncer prefetcher is what warms map tiles ahead of your plugin's viewport requests, so if tiles show up blank or stale, start here. Plugin authors can tweak prefetch radius via the manifest, but anything touching eviction or cache headers needs a review first. For API questions, quirks, and prefetch bugs, ping the maintainer listed below.

named custodian: Belius Casath Ulaix Sorius

## Authentication

Digestwheel schedules batch email digests via the /v2/schedules endpoint. All requests require a bearer token in the Authorization header. Tokens are scoped per tenant; support staff should use the shared read-only support token for lookups and never the tenant write token. Tokens expire after 12 hours; request renewal through the Mossgate console. Rate limit: 60 calls/minute. For quick triage of failed digest runs in the sandbox, use the support token below.

session JWT of tadup-kaguf = eyJhbGciOiJIUzI1NiIsInR5cCI6IkpXVCJ9.eyJzdWIiOiItNz4V3In0.KrZCeqpk

Welcome to the Corvand platform team. Every service pod runs our metrics-aggregation sidecar, Tallyvane, which batches counters and histograms before forwarding them to the central store in the Delmore cluster. As a contractor you'll mostly touch its scrape configs; never edit the flush interval without a review, since it affects billing rollups. Access to the sidecar's sealed configuration repo goes through a recovery-style login on first use, and that login accepts only the passphrase shown below.

vault phrase of bagaf-kajeg = jorath-feniel-briir-siliel-ralix